About Dreams Vista Cancun Resort & Spa

Dreams Vista Cancun Resort & Spa, a brand new, contemporary all ocean view family resort, is perfectly set in the exclusive gated community of Puerta del Mar, adjacent to Puerto Cancun Golf Club and Shopping Center, 30 minutes away from the Cancun International Airport. The Resort's prime location is close to the wonders and ruins of the Mayan Riviera - but everything a guest needs is here and it's all included with Unlimited-Luxury®. Housing luxuriously equipped rooms, all with a modern and stunning architectural design, this locale offers breathtaking views of the Caribbean Sea and nearby Isla Mujeres. Featuring a relaxing world-class Spa by Pevonia®, two surf pools, a splash park, an exclusive rooftop pool, countless daytime activities and exciting nightlife, makes this a must-stay destination. Delicious reservation-free dining is available at four à la carte specialty restaurants, a buffet, food hall and CoCo Café. Guests can relax with unlimited drinks - by the pool, on the beach, at the rooftop bar or while dancing at the Desires nightclub. Dreams vista Cancun is the perfect place for a worry-free, unforgettable vacation!” Kids activities, great beach, watersports, surf pool for stationary wave surfing. 4 pools to choose incl. splash pool for children and an adults-only Preferred Club rooftop pool. The Explorer’s Club for Kids provides supervised fun for 3 -12 Ages 13-17 have Core Zone Teens Club to socialize, and fun games.The fully equipped Spa by Pevonia offers relaxing treatments, modern treatment cabins, hydrotherapy circuit, beauty salón, fitness center.

We just got back from a 5 day stay and wanted to share about our experience at Dreams Vista! Overall I would rate this resort a 4.5/5 🌟

Food/Drinks:
- The a la carte restaurants overall were delicious and had great menus. My favourites were Bluewater (the short rib!!!) and Himitsu. I was very excited for Vista and did not enjoy it at all. The service was very slow and the food came out so cold. We didn’t try the Mexican. Easy to make reservations on the app 1-2 days in advance. Reservations are encouraged for a la cartes but you can also walk in, though you might wait a while.
- The buffet overall was alright, it was fairly small and seemed to have similar items every day. Some days certain items were delicious and the next not so great. I would say it’s good for breakfast/lunch but I would suggest the a la cartes for dinner.
- Both breakfast and lunch at Bluewater were very good, highly recommend!
- Loved La Plaza for lunch as it gave good variety, with fresh tacos and sushi, and a grill section. Sushi was slow but it’s because they make every roll fresh to order.
- The drinks overall were very good and a good amount of alcohol! The fresh juice used in the drinks was incredible. I loved the mango margarita and mango mimosa best. I will say that the drinks in the preferred lounge were way better compared to the drinks in the lobby bar.
- Cocos was a nice bonus and had dairy free milks to make all of their drinks! They also had regular cookies/donuts/muffins, and gluten free treats as well.
- Part of why I booked is because I heard Dreams is good for gluten and dairy free. I will say that typically they had good options, though sometimes inconsistent (ie with gluten free bread, etc). Always check with the waiter about what is gluten and dairy free though, because the menu was definitely incorrect with some items.
- Room service is open all times a day, which is a great bonus!
- Teppenyaki is not included and is an extra price. This was a bit disappointing because when we booked, it was included in the all inclusive price.

Room:
- We had the preferred club ocean view room with a hot tub. Note that the hot tub is just a jacuzzi tub inside of the room. This was a slight disappointment, as when we turned the jets on there was debris coming out of the jets. We tried a few times and then just gave up on using it. They did offer to switch our room but we were already settled.
- Otherwise the room was absolutely beautiful! Huge shower and bathroom area, living area with couch, big closet, bed was comfortable. Because of where our room was located we did have bars on our balcony but most rooms didn’t. I can imagine every room has a beautiful view!
- Great water pressure and heat in the shower!!! Also good AC. Room came with a blow drier, steamer, and lots of amenities (toothbrush and paste, even a razor).
- I would recommend to not upgrade to the hot tub or swim out options, as neither looked great. All of the rooms seemed to be similar layout and beautiful, so I don’t think an upgrade is necessary.
- Nice touches to the room; we were celebrating our anniversary and my birthday so they put banners on the door and a bottle of sparkling wine out. We got a small bottle of tequila, pringles, and m&ms. They even give you a beach tote! Lots of soft drinks and beer in the mini fridge.

Resort:
- We were hesitant because everything is essentially in one location in this resort, but it still felt really big and we feel we didn’t even get to explore every spot there! So if you’re worried about it feeling small, it’s definitely not.
- The views from everywhere are so beautiful, especially the rooftop!
- It’s a very clean resort, you can tell it’s newer. Also very modern style!

Pools/Beach:
- We spent a lot of our time in the main long pool, which was beautiful and never felt too busy. It was a bit cold but we didn’t mind with the heat from the sun! Bar tenders were also great here and came around very frequently. Lots of loungers available, sun and shade. I will mention that the sun goes behind the hotel at around 4:30/5 and then it gets a bit windy/cold in this pool.
- The preferred club rooftop pool was beautiful as well and overlooked the ocean. Never too busy and the drink service here was also excellent.
- If you’re a beach person, I wouldn’t recommend this resort. There is a beach section and it looked like many were enjoying it, however the seaweed was a problem (they did their best though!!), it was a bit rocky, and it is quite a small beach area. We didn’t mind because the pools were so great!

Activities:
- We didn’t do too many activities but we did see there were non motorized beach activities, volleyball, aerobics, nightly shows, and tons for kids! I also saw wine tasting and tequila tasting but again, we didn’t take part. It did seem like there was something for everyone!
- The surf area was a very cool touch, for both kids and adults!

Preferred:
- I would 100% recommend preferred, especially if you are not travelling with children. The rooftop pool was beautiful, the additional Bluewater restaurant, the preferred lounge (we watched lots of baseball here and the drinks were always great! They also have food if you need a snack), the preferred check in… Definitely all perks! We also enjoyed the top shelf liquor options.

Weather:
- The weather was great when we were there, sunny and warm and barely any rain. It did get a bit cloudy some days which made it a bit cooler, but no complaints.
- I know the wind is a big topic of conversation, and we were a bit worried! It did get windy in the main pool at around 4:30/5 which made it cooler. There were also some common areas that got quite windy… But it really didn’t bother us, the breeze was welcomed! Don’t let it deter you from booking.

Service/Tipping:
- The service was incredible, maybe best I’ve had at an all inclusive. Very attentive, going the extra mile, and making sure you don’t need to worry about anything.
- We did tip in Mexican pesos (as Canadians, it didn’t make sense to bring American dollars, but they seemed to happily accept both). For five days, I would suggest around $200 Canadian. The staff work very hard and deserve some extra love! But they never seemed to push for tips or expect them, the service was good always.

Overall we really enjoyed our stay at Dreams Vista and would love to check out more Dreams or Secrets resorts ❤️
